Jesus spoke frequently about His future return and the end times. Here are some relevant verses:

“But about that day or hour no one knows, not even the angels in heaven, nor the Son, but only the Father.” (Matthew 24:36)

“Therefore keep watch, because you do not know on what day your Lord will come.” (Matthew 24:42)

“When the Son of Man comes in his glory, and all the angels with him, he will sit on his glorious throne.” (Matthew 25:31)

Three Main Takeaways:

  1. Timing Unknown: Jesus made it clear that the exact timing of His return is unknown, even to Himself, and is known only to the Father.
  2. Call to Watchfulness: Because of the uncertainty about the timing, Jesus repeatedly urged His followers to remain watchful, alert, and ready for His return.
  3. Glorious Advent: When He does return, Jesus said it will be a glorious and visible event, with Him coming in power with the angels to establish His throne and kingdom.

In His teachings, Jesus emphasized the certainty of His future return, while also highlighting the need for ongoing vigilance, preparedness, and righteous living as we await that momentous day. His words instill a sense of eager anticipation tempered by the mystery of not knowing the precise timing.
